Re: 1982 Mercury 500/50hp 4cyl

No, compression check will not indicate bad reed valve. Assuming everything else (carb, ignition, etc) is correct a bad reed valve is indicated by bad idle.

Re: 1982 Mercury 500/50hp 4cyl

Thanks for your reply.

My idle is slightly rough, not even sure rough is the right word, it seems to have a slight miss while idling, its not jumping all over the place at all.

While in the ocean & increasing my throttle towards WOT the missing gets progressively more noticeable........& at times seems to be surging very slightly....when I bought this engine the gentleman said he had rebuilt the Carbs. & fuel pumps & had replaced the stator & some electrical items that he said Mercury was prone to have had problems with during these years.

While idling:
1. I disconnected each plug wire from the spark plug one at a time & each time it affected the idle...ran rough. which is good. also the spark looked great real strong on all plug wires.
2. I squeezed the bulb in the gas line and it had no effect on the engine idle & I sprayed a mixture of oil/gas into each Carb throat & it had no effect on idle....it did if I sprayed to much..........but that's normal.

Having one carb per 2cyl's.....if I disconnect 2 plug wires, at idle should this engine beable to run on 2cyl's ?
